 5.2. Stored Data Menu

 Delete Stored Data (Not available on 21 CFR, Part 11 compliant units) Analyze Stored Data 5.2. Stored Data Menu

This function is used to work with data stored in the instrument from past tests. Up to 1,000 test results and 100 graphs can be stored before the oldest is "pushed out" (overwritten). To access this function, go to the Main Menu and select the STORED DATA MENU. On 21 CFR, Part 11 compliant units, the DELETE is not available.

Manual backgroundManual background Delete Stored Data (Not available on 21 CFR, Part 11 compliant units)

This function is used to delete individual results and is non-reversible. Normally results are deleted to make management of the data easier. If the test results need to be saved, they should first be printed or stored in a computer file. Moving the selector bar to a particular test and pressing [DELETE] will erase the record so be careful! If the list is empty, the screen will show EMPTY.

Manual backgroundManual background Analyze Stored Data

Mean, Standard Deviation, and Relative Standard Deviation are calculated using the following formulas available on many hand calculators.

Mean = total of results divided by number of results.
